The Stockharbor reconciliation job runs nightly at 02:00 UTC, comparing warehouse counts against ledger snapshots and emitting a diff report per facility. Discrepancies above the configured tolerance open a review ticket automatically. The job is idempotent; reruns overwrite the same report slot. When triggering a manual run through the admin endpoint, supply the bearer token below in the Authorization header.

bearer token for tawig-bahif: eyJhbGciOiJIUzI1NiIsInR5cCI6IkpXVCJ9.eyJzdWIiOiIo-yiO33jvEIn0.T9qLInSAqhTN

## Catalogue import — recovery steps

If the nightly Thistledown catalogue import stalls, first check the staging table row count against the source manifest; a mismatch over 1% means the feed was truncated upstream. Re-run with `--resume-from-checkpoint` rather than a full restart, since full restarts invalidate the dedupe cache. Log every re-run in the import journal, including the build identifier shown below.

pipeline stamp: htk31_f769b577b3028a4e9958e5bb8d1259a

**Action item (INC follow-up): Varrow Assign service**

Sticky assignments expired early during the outage, so some users flipped experiment arms mid-session. Support: if customers report inconsistent features, check assignment timestamps before escalating. Fix shipped; TTLs and cache bounds were retuned to prevent recurrence. Do not manually reassign users. Escalate only if flips persist past the new TTL window. Revised constants are listed below.

tuning table, yaweg-kajef:
WEIGHTS = {
    "ralwyn": 573,
    "praius": 56,
    "eliok": 19,
}

// Shard placement for the Personafile profile store.
// Plugin authors: keys are hashed into a fixed ring of virtual
// shards, then mapped to physical nodes. Do not derive shard
// indices yourself; always call the routing helper, since the
// virtual-to-physical mapping can change during rebalances while
// the ring size never does. Resizing the ring is a migration,
// not a config change. The ring and rebalance parameters follow below.

tuning table, kajog-kawef:
PRIORITIES = {
    "kelox": 870,
    "kasix": 89,
    "eliax": 988,
}